This is an established section of Sun City Center in Hillsborough County, with 521 homes built between 1968 and 2001 and a median build year of 1991. At a median of roughly 1,958 living square feet, the housing stock is mid-sized and consistent, which means price here is driven far less by square footage and far more by condition, updates, and how much original 1990s finish is still in place. Expect a wide spread between a maintained, updated home and one that needs work.
With closings limited to a two-property window in the current snapshot, there is not enough recent transaction volume to call a hard price trend — so treat any single comp with caution and lean on condition-adjusted analysis. A homestead share near 79% points to a stable, owner-occupied base and modest turnover, which tends to keep listings from stacking up. Sellers should price to condition and be patient; buyers should underwrite renovation and system-age costs on anything that still reads original.

A condition-driven resale market
The build range spans 1968 to 2001 with the median landing in 1991, so you are looking at homes that are decades into their service life. That is not a negative — it means major systems (roof, HVAC, plumbing, electrical panels, windows) are the pivot point of value. Two homes of nearly identical size can trade very differently depending on whether those items have been replaced. Bring an inspector who will document system ages, and read every listing through that lens.
The tight, consistent median size around 1,958 square feet works in a buyer's favor for comparison shopping: with less floor-plan variation, it is easier to isolate what you are actually paying for in condition and finish. The high homestead share suggests homes here are held rather than flipped, so well-maintained inventory can be genuinely scarce and worth moving on when it appears.
